Etsy Dallas Trunk Show Recap (and giveaway!)

Saturday Joe & I had the pleasure of attending the second Etsy Dallas trunk show. After a rocky start to the morning (ie: car accident), we arrived to find tons of terrific vendors displaying their fabulously funky designs. We caught up with previous Funky Finds including Patti Haskins, Designing Diva, Harrilu, & Tefi Designs. It's wonderful to see these designers regularly, giving us the opportunity get to know them & their work. We also met many new designers who are definitely Funky Finds!

Cindi Albright's Christian-based company, Rustique Art, features beautiful hand-crafted crosses. The vintage beaded crosses are stunning (pictured). Cindi is more than happy to create custom crosses to match any specific color scheme you request. Rustique Art also features barbed wire crosses, steel crosses, and more.

It was a pleasure visiting with the mother daughter team that is Moon's Harvest. This dynamic duo creates a wide array of bath & body products, including bubbly bars & dry oil mists. I will be reviewing many of their products later this week. Also, don't miss the fantastic one-of-a-kind hand-crafted jewelry designed by Erica Jean.

Susan Bradford of Sadie's Things creates beautiful antiqued brass jewelry. Using her own methods to speed up the aging process, Susan works in her "lab" to create a unique look. I was determined to treat my mom (and myself!) to some of Susan's earrings, but it was not easy choosing from all the gorgeous designs. (pictured)

We had a wonderful chat with two charismatic women who shared a booth. Mary's Madness features cool charm bracelets, vintage button jewelry & much more. This designer also has another Etsy shop, The Altered Black Sheep, showcasing unique pieces such as the silverware jewelry. Booth-mate Ellen Bennett of Ellen's Treasures is a delightful bundle of energy. She designs handbags (pictured), & children's items, such as burp cloths & bibs. I loved the Let's Meet for Coffee bag.

Christy Robinson was another jewelry designer I enjoyed visiting with. Christy actually has a studio located at the site where the trunk show was held. It was interesting to see the space where she designs & sells her designs on a regular basis. Christy strives to create unique jewelry that is hip & affordable. Her hand-stamped designs were among my favorites, as well as the rings.

We also met Cherry of Cherry's Creations & Tamara of TP Designs, both of which are participating in upcoming funky giveaways. Cherry designs jewelry which features recycled & repurposed elements. The wire wrapped pendants are exceptionally fabulous! Tamara is a talented photographer & artist whose work would be a great addition to any space. (pictured)

Good Scents Bath Company offers a variety of products designed to pamper you from head to toe. I purchased some of the Luscious Lips ultra moisturizing lip balm & I have to tell you this stuff rocks! Created using Shea Oil, Natural Vitamin E Oil, & Sun-bleached Beeswax this lip balm stays on forever. Good Scents now offers Luscious Lips Tints, as well.
